Pearson's Notes
The 2009 Mitsuko's Vineyard Sauvignon Blanc entices with its intense and complex aromas of passion fruit, pineapple, melon and dried grass, with undertones of tangerine, grapefruit and flint. The wine possesses vibrant minerality and pitch-perfect acidity counterbalanced by richness, depth and lengthy fruit flavors. Wine Enthusiast - 91 points
The best Clos Pegase Sauvignon Blanc in years. Made with a little oak, just enough for creaminess, it’s marked by vibrant acidity and complex, lovely flavors of lemongrass, Meyer lemon candy, vanilla, white pepper and the distinct minerality that Carneros white wines often display. Great price for a wine this sophisticated.
